The Minister of Land Department, Jordi Torres Falcó and the Mayor of  Encamp Jordi Torres Arauz, signed the cooperation agreement by which the Town Hall of Encamp yields a parcel of land to the Government for the future National Heliport, which should be operational in 2019.

The government will assume the cost of all planned activities prior to the completion of work and the construction of the heliport, which will be declared a Project of National Interest.

The urbanizational work will begin this year, and the infrastructure will be built next year, allowing Helicopters to operate in 2019.  

The 4,000 to 6,000 square meter airport facility will be located in an industrial zone away from residential areas. Helicopters will have a maximum capacity of fifteen places
